The new 2,500 sq. m Learning Garden of CUHK University Library opened 24/7 in November 2012. The Learning Garden is equipped with modern learning facilities that facilitate individual and collaborative study. These 24/7 facilities are widely welcomed by students. Nearly 500 users are found staying during peak hours, and amazingly, an average of over 2,700 canned drinks sold per month. The presentation shares the challenges in the first year of operations and the way forward in sustaining the Learning Garden as a welcoming space for students to enjoy the funs of learning and sharing throughout their student journeys at CUHK.
